By
ERNEST WALKER, M.R.C.S.,
L.R.C.P. (Lond.)

Crown 8vo, Paper 1/- net. Cloth 1/6 net.

This work is scientific and up to date; all technical and misleading terms are omitted, and the diseases are classified alphabetically and under their popular names.

The treatment is scientific and simple and nothing is advised that cannot be carried out at home.

The description of complicated symptoms and treatment is avoided.

The signs of severe illnesses are given, so that the disease may be recognised and the patient comforted by simple home remedies till skilled help is obtained.

The want of a little medical or surgical knowledge has led to the loss of many lives which might have been saved, and this book conveys to the unskilled reader in a few trenchant and simple sentences the best way to act in all emergencies.

An invaluable volume and one which ought to be in every home library.
